Notice: Function _load_textdomain_just_in_time was called incorrectly. Translation loading for the MWP-Firewall domain was triggered too early. This is usually an indicator for some code in the plugin or theme running too early. Translations should be loaded at the init action or later. Please see Debugging in WordPress for more information. (This message was added in version 6.7.0.) in /home/E4wU9yBtpX5OW19y/wpf202503/public_html/wp-includes/functions.php on line 6121

Deprecated: Creation of dynamic property SureCart\Licensing\Updater::$cache_key is deprecated in /home/E4wU9yBtpX5OW19y/wpf202503/public_html/wp-content/plugins/MWP-Firewall/licensing/src/Updater.php on line 22
Contact Form 7 Calendar Plugin Security Vulnerability [CVE-2025-46510]

Contact Form 7 日历插件安全漏洞 [CVE-2025-46510]

admin

了解并缓解 Contact Form 7 日历插件漏洞

作为 WordPress 安全专家,及时了解影响热门插件(例如 Contact Form 7 日历插件)的漏洞至关重要。最近,该插件 3.0.1 版本中发现了一个重大漏洞,该漏洞结合了跨站请求伪造 (CSRF) 和存储型跨站脚本 (XSS)。本文将深入探讨此漏洞的细节、其影响以及如何保护您的 WordPress 网站免受此类威胁。

漏洞介绍

Contact Form 7 日历插件旨在通过集成日历功能来增强 Contact Form 7 的功能。然而,该插件的 3.0.1 版本存在一个漏洞,允许攻击者利用 CSRF 和存储型 XSS 漏洞。

  • 跨站请求伪造(CSRF): 此类攻击会诱骗用户在经过身份验证的 Web 应用程序上执行非预期操作。在 Contact Form 7 日历插件中,攻击者可能会在用户不知情或未经其同意的情况下,操纵用户执行恶意请求。
  • 存储型跨站脚本(XSS): 攻击者将恶意脚本注入网站,并将其存储在服务器上,从而导致网站被黑。当其他用户访问受影响的页面时,恶意脚本会在其浏览器中执行,这可能导致未经授权的操作、数据窃取或进一步的攻击。

漏洞的影响

Contact Form 7 日历插件中的 CSRF 和存储型 XSS 漏洞对 WordPress 网站构成了重大威胁。以下是一些潜在影响:

  1. 未经授权的操作: 攻击者可以使用 CSRF 诱骗管理员执行他们不想执行的操作,例如修改插件设置或注入恶意脚本。
  2. 数据盗窃: 存储型 XSS 可用于窃取会话 cookie 等敏感信息,从而允许攻击者冒充用户或未经授权访问网站。
  3. 恶意脚本执行: 攻击者可以注入脚本,将用户重定向到钓鱼网站、安装恶意软件或执行其他恶意活动。

缓解策略

为了保护您的 WordPress 网站免受此漏洞的侵害,请考虑以下策略:

1.更新插件

最直接的解决方案是将 Contact Form 7 日历插件更新到修复漏洞的版本。请确保您使用的是最新版本的插件。

2.禁用插件

如果没有可用的更新,请暂时禁用该插件,直到发布安全版本。这将阻止攻击者利用此漏洞。

3. 实施安全措施

  • CSRF保护: 确保你的网站已部署强大的 CSRF 防护机制。这包括使用必须包含在请求中的令牌来验证其合法性。
  • 输入验证和清理: 始终验证并清理用户输入,以防止恶意脚本注入您的网站。
  • 定期安全审计: 定期进行安全审计,以识别并解决漏洞,防止其被利用。

4. 使用 Web 应用程序防火墙 (WAF)

WAF 可以过滤恶意流量并阻止常见的 Web 攻击(包括 CSRF 和 XSS 攻击),从而保护您的网站。它充当一道额外的防御层,提供实时防护,抵御已知和未知的威胁。

5.监控用户活动

密切关注用户活动,尤其是管理操作。异常行为可能预示着受到攻击。

WordPress 安全最佳实践

除了解决特定的漏洞之外,维护强大的 WordPress 安全性还涉及几个最佳实践:

  1. 保持软件为最新版本: 定期更新 WordPress 核心、主题和插件,以确保您拥有最新的安全补丁。
  2. 使用强密码: 确保所有用户都拥有强大且独特的密码,并考虑实施双因素身份验证。
  3. 限制用户权限: 仅授予用户执行任务所需的权限,减少账户被盗造成的潜在损害。
  4. 定期备份: 定期备份可以帮助您在遭受攻击或数据丢失时快速恢复。
  5. 监控恶意软件: 使用安全工具扫描您的网站是否存在恶意软件和其他威胁。

结论

Contact Form 7 日历插件中的漏洞凸显了保持 WordPress 安全警惕的重要性。通过了解风险并实施有效的缓解策略,您可以保护您的网站免受潜在攻击。定期更新、强大的安全措施和持续监控是维护安全在线形象的关键。


wordpress security update banner

免费接收 WP 安全周刊 👋
立即注册
!!

注册以每周在您的收件箱中接收 WordPress 安全更新。

我们不发送垃圾邮件!阅读我们的 隐私政策 了解更多信息。